Traditional Roof
With all the roofing styles and designs that you can select in the market today, you most likely require a little help to press you to the right instructions. Appropriate preparation and considerable time ought to be set aside in picking the perfect roofing design that would best fit your house. Roofing systems greatly contribute to the look you desire your house to depict.
thinking about classic roofing styles, you'll perhaps discover the variety practically limitless. From clay to metal tile, you can be certain that you can find the style that would best compliment your house. Traditional roof frequently needs a considerable amount of workmanship and expertise. Adding roofing system details would greatly contribute to the beauty and sophistication of the roofing. That is why aside from choosing premium grade products, it is similarly crucial to employ only the best roofer in your area. This would guarantee remarkable quality craftsmanship and your complete satisfaction.
Often, the usage recycled roofing products are perfectly appropriate to help you in accomplishing the traditional roofing style to want to pull off. It is likewise recommended to use the lightweight, synthetic items if you like the conventional, traditional roof style.
conventional roof products typically used frequently can not withstand high winds and other severe weather condition elements as successfully as artificial materials. There are steel tiles which are developed to appear like timeless roofing tile however with the advantage of simpler setup and considerably less expensive too. Artificial roof materials are readily available in different designs and textures that you can pick from to accomplish the look you seek for your roofing system. The artificial traditional roofing will not just give you the protection and coverage versus harsh weather conditions, you can with confidence expect it to last longer than the basic cedar or slate roofing systems.
There are lots of newer slates and imitation shakes that are in fact filled with rubber substances, making it capable to much better hinder the hazardous UV rays, and more durable and fire resistant. Artificial products are notably a lot easier to set up using air pressured nail guns.
Be sure to examine the benefits of every alternative when first deciding the design of roof to wish to adjust. Decide which design that will best improve the appeal of your house, and would still provide the durability that you require.

Flat Roofs
Flat roofings are an excellent way to keep a structure safe from water. Knowing precisely what to do with a flat roofing system will ensure you have a working roof system that will last a very long time.
may look good, and are extremely common, flat roofing systems do require regular upkeep and detailed repair work in order to efficiently avoid water seepage. correctly, you'll more than happy with your flat roofing system for a very long time.
Flat roofing systems aren't as attractive and/or popular as its newer counterparts, such as slate, tile, or copper roofs. They are simply as crucial and require even more attention. In order to prevent discarding cash on short-term repairs, you must know precisely how flat roofing system systems are created, the various types of flat roofs that are available, and the significance of regular evaluation and maintenance.
A flat roof system works by supplying a water resistant membrane over a structure. It includes several layers of hydrophobic products that is placed over a structural deck with a vapor barrier that is generally put in between roofing system membrane.
Flashing, or thin strips of product such as copper, intersect with the membrane and the other building components to avoid water infiltration. The water is then directed to drains pipes, downspouts, and gutters by the roofing's slight pitch.
There are 4 most typical kinds of flat roofing systems. Noted in order of increasing sturdiness and cost, they are: roll asphalt, single-ply membrane, built-up or multiple-ply, and flat-seamed metal. They can vary anywhere from as low as $2 per square foot for roll asphalt or single-ply roofing that is used over and existing roofing system, to $20 per square foot or more for new metal roofs.
Utilized considering that the 1890s, asphalt roll roofing typically consists of one layer of asphalt-saturated natural or fiberglass base felts that are used over roofing felt with nails and cold asphalt cement and generally covered with a granular mineral surface area. The seams are typically covered over with a roofing substance. It can last about 10 years.
Single-ply membrane roofing is the most recent type of roof material. It is frequently utilized to change multiple-ply roofings. 10 to 12 year warranties are normal, however proper setup is important and upkeep is still required.
Built-up or multiple-ply roof, also referred to as BUR, is made from overlapping rolls of saturated or coated felts or mats that are sprinkled with layers of bitumen and surfaced with a granular roof sheet, tile, or ballast pavers that are utilized to safeguard the underlying products from the weather condition. BURs are designed to last 10 to 30 years, which depends on the materials utilized.
Ballast, or aggregate, of crushed stone or water-worn gravel is embedded in a covering of asphalt or coal tar. Considering that the ballast or tile pavers cover the membrane, it makes inspecting and keeping the seams of the roofing hard.
Last but not least, flat-seamed roofs have been used since the 19 th century. Made from little pieces of sheet metal soldered flush at the joints, it can last many years depending on the quality of the direct exposure, upkeep, and product to the elements.
Galvanized metal does need routine painting in order to prevent rust and split joints need to be resoldered. Other metal surfaces, such as copper, can end up being pitted and pinholed from acid raid and normally needs replacing. Today copper, lead-coated copper, and terne-coated stainless steel are preferred as long-lasting flat roofs.
